Filmmakers Brandon LaGanke and John Carlucci of Ghost+Cow Films bring a whole new genre to music videos with their latest viral film Drone Boning, featuring the feel-good song ‘The Kink’ by Taggart and Rosewood. Many may not be too familiar with the concept of Drone Boning but it simply means drones watching you bone. The voyeuristic video pans into breathtaking aerial shots of vineyards, hills, forests, and suddenly plot twist! Naked people banging in the background. It doesn’t get bolder than that. That, and the lingering sense of awkwardness that comes with watching people doing it from sky high. One of the directors mentioned that “… wouldn’t it be funny to have these simplistic, beautiful landscapes, and have people fucking in them.” Indeed, but what started off as a cheeky commentary on NSFW and issues on privacy has achieved global attention as a conceptual music video that puts Nicki Minaj’s ‘Anaconda’ to shame.

As potent as the video is conceptually though, it would be a wise decision to keep your eyes out for more from Taggart and Rosewood, a duo comprising Zach Coulter (Solid Gold) and Ryan Olson (Polica), both founding members of Gayngs, with Jim Eno (Spoon) on drums. Reason being that their music is poetically crafted with the aid of an “Emotiv EEG to USB brain computer interface through the Logic MIDI bridge”. A whole load of science gobbledygook, but it really just means that the music they make consists of the recorded synapses of the pair’s brains under the influence of DMT. Talk about being unique.
